技术文摘
Python 实现房产数据爬取并于地图展示
2024-12-31 12:47:23 小编
Python 实现房产数据爬取并于地图展示
在当今数字化时代,数据的价值日益凸显。对于房产领域,通过 Python 实现房产数据的爬取并在地图上展示,能够为用户提供更直观、全面的信息。
我们需要明确数据的来源。常见的房产数据网站包括各大房产中介平台、房产信息发布网站等。在进行爬取时,要注意遵守网站的使用规则和法律法规,避免非法获取数据。
使用 Python 中的相关库,如 Requests 和 BeautifulSoup ,可以轻松地发送请求并解析网页内容,获取所需的房产数据。这些数据可能包括房产的位置、面积、价格、户型等关键信息。
获取到房产数据后,接下来就是将其与地图进行结合展示。这里可以借助一些地图 API ,如百度地图 API 、高德地图 API 等。通过调用这些 API ,将房产的地理位置信息标注在地图上,并可以根据不同的属性设置不同的标记样式和颜色。
在数据处理和地图展示的过程中,还需要进行数据的清洗和整理。例如,处理重复数据、纠正错误的地址信息等,以确保展示的准确性和可靠性。
为了提升用户体验,可以添加交互功能。用户可以通过点击地图上的标记,获取更详细的房产信息,或者进行筛选、排序等操作,以便快速找到符合自己需求的房产。
通过 Python 实现房产数据的爬取并在地图上展示,不仅为购房者提供了便捷的查询方式,也为房产研究人员和相关从业者提供了有力的数据分析工具。但也要注意保护用户隐私和数据安全,确保数据的合法合规使用。
Python 为房产数据的获取和展示提供了强大的技术支持,让我们能够更高效地利用数据,为房产市场的发展和决策提供有力的依据。
- 行业规模知识图谱:经验与挑战
- Java 基础:强引用、弱引用、软引用、虚引用
- Go 语言基础结构体(冬日版)
- Go 基础编程之结构体
- Apache Beam 及其相较其他选择的优势所在
- 五大常用算法之分支算法及思想图解
- Python 爬取抖音 APP 视频的方法
- 为 Python 游戏添加声音
- Django 项目及应用创建的干货知识分享
- 持续监控的 12 个高价值 Kubernetes 健康指标
- C++与其他语言相比究竟难在何处?
- 老板:所写接口存问题,速起查看
- Jackson 的 Java JSON 解析工具
- GitHub 中的 50 个 Kubernetes DevOps 工具
- C 语言指针的超详细解读(附代码)